"'Vendetta' is an interesting level that takes you through a sleepy Brazilian zoo in a quest to find 3 roses; air, earth, and water. On top of numerous guards (too many in fact!), you will become well acquainted with the local residents. The areas for the roses are not too difficult, but are lessons instead of observation. Placing the roses in the underwater caves opens gates to a room of vast nothingness. Grabbing the artifact transforms the room into a bridge above lava, and a confrontation with an old nemesis begins. I don't know if this was a problem that occurred while downloading, but I found this section to be very glitchy. The beasts kept falling off the ledges and down into the lava at random, they also kept getting stuck in the walls, and Sophia's staff wasn't shooting anything. An okay level overall, frustrating at times because of all the guards, but enjoyable in the end." - Celli (28-Aug-2005)

"The first thing you see is a good fly-by which shows that Lara has arrived at the zoo and inspired from one of Christina Aguilera's latest video's bought herself a sexy outfit lol. This definitely is Lucas' best level to date and even if he says he doesn't want to make levels anymore I hope he finds the inspiration for new creations as this one was very promising. Even if the hunt for the 3 roses is more shooter like and switch based it was very fun and I enjoyed the 30 minutes I spent in thoroughly. The environment reminds me of the Zoo and city area of TR3: The lost artefact - It's a Madhouse! level. There are some new objects in the game and nice new firearms. The new guns include submachine guns which replace the uzis a new much better looking shotgun and a grappling gun which can be used offensive against your enemies but has more use to create a rope or 2 during the play time. Near the end Lara of course gets the 4 meteorite artifacts back and gains a new one too you have a tough battle with 4 werewolves and Sophia at the end and once everything is done you escape through the water. But when you try to place the golden tear Sophia left Lara is pulled in a water current and taken away from the exit. Does this mean there will be another follow up? I certainly hope so!" - eTux (12-May-2003)
